What's some good roads?
I'm planning a little scooter ride in the next few weeks or so. I've heard and read a lot about the Tail of the Dragon. So I'm going to head in that general direction and run it. I'm going to start my back road ride by taking Rt23 out of Columbus,Oh and in to WV. Most likely follow it thru Virginia and Tenn. Hit the Dragon n to s then loop around to northern Georgia to the Chattahoochee nat forest area. Seeing I don't have a job right now I'll be tenting it as much as I can. So camping info is a big help or older CLEAN cheap motels,cabins kind of 50's style. Can any of you help out with other roads along that basic route which are good riding? I like all types, twisties, scenic, fast, slow what ever. TIA

Blue Ridge Parkway, Cherohala Skyway, pretty much anything in that part of the TN / NC area is good. I love the Cherohala Skyway personally. Not nearly as intense as the Dragon but the scenery is fantastic. At the Tennessee end of the Cherohala Skyway, in Tellico Plains, TN, there are a couple of motorcycle campground / lodges. I stayed at the Cherohala Motorcycle Resort last year and it is really nice. Not fancy nice, but comfy and clean nice. A single occupancy cabin is $40 a night. Camping is $12 a night. The Dragon
I live a few miles from the Dragon. Best to ride it during a weekday. Weekend are pretty busy and you really have to worry bout other riders going high in curves and entering your line of fire. It is a great road but you really have to worry bout the other guy and the leaf peepers. They also have the Lake drained up there to fix Chilhowee dam so you got alot of locals up to see that.
I don't know where you are coming from but if you go to Maryville, TN. to 321 towards Townsend then right onto the Foothills Parkway,(also a great rd.) there is a park run camground on top of Foothills that is just a few miles from the Dragon. It is called Look Rock. It is the only road off of the parkway. If you stay on Foothills it will dead in at 129 take a left and Dragon starts just a little ways up the rd. Also do some research on the Cherahola Skyway. |
